Maine minimum coverage requirements
- Bodily Injury Liability: 50/100 thousand per person / per accident
- Property Damage Liability: $25K
Cheapest state for auto insurance — low claims frequency despite high coverage minimums.

Methodology: Estimated annual premium is computed as USAA's national average ($1,065) multiplied by Maine's state-vs-national premium index ($1,000 ÷ national average $1,789 ≈ 0.56x). Actual quotes vary by ±15-25% based on driver age, ZIP code, vehicle, mileage, and coverage selections. Sources: NAIC rate-filings 2023-2024, J.D. Power 2024 U.S. Auto Insurance Study, individual carrier rate filings. USAA J.D. Power score: 890/1000. A.M. Best rating: A++ (2024).
